These rates of decay are recognized, so if you can measure the proportion of father or mother and daughter isotopes in rocks now, you can calculate when the rocks have been shaped. Absolute dating methods measure the physical properties of an object itself and use these measurements to calculate its age. One of the most helpful absolute relationship methods for archaeologists is called radiocarbon courting. It works by measuring carbon isotopes, that are versions of the component carbon.

Scientists excited about figuring out the age of a fossil or rock analyze a sample to determine the ratio of a given radioactive factor’s daughter isotope (or isotopes) to its parent isotope in that pattern. With the element’s decay price, and hence its half-life, recognized prematurely, calculating its age is easy.
